Shrewsbury Historical Society announces scholarship recipients

Sarah Kelland. Photo/Submitted

Shrewsbury – As part of its outreach to the community, the Shrewsbury Historical Society recently presented two scholarships.

Sarah Kelland was the recipient of the Shrewsbury Historical Society Stephen Porter Scholarship. She will attend Bentley University.  Griffin Monahan was the recipient of the Shrewsbury Historical Society Jean McDonald Graham Scholarship. He will attend Boston University.

The Shrewsbury Historical Society was organized in 1898 and incorporated on June 23, 1902. As part of its mission statement, the purpose of the Society is to “keep alive and increase interest in the history of the town of Shrewsbury.”
